Mississippi · 2026 Regular Session
An Act To Provide That It Shall Be Unlawful For Any Person Who Is The Subject Of Certain Domestic Restraining Orders Or Who Has Been Convicted Of A Misdemeanor Crime Of Domestic Violence To Possess Any Firearm Or Ammunition; To Provide A Criminal Penalty; To Amend Section 93–21–9, Mississippi Code Of 1972, To Provide That A Petitioner Who Requests The Removal Of Firearms Or Ammunition From An Individual Alleged To Have Committed Abuse As Relief In A Domestic Abuse Protection Order Shall State The Facts And Circumstances That Merit Such Relief With Particularity; To Require The Mississippi Judicial College To Annually Review The Standardized Form Required Under This Section And Distribute Any Revised Form To The Courts; To Amend Section 93–21–15, Mississippi Code Of 1972, To Authorize A Court In A Temporary Or Final Domestic Abuse Protection Order To Order Law Enforcement To Remove A Respondent's Firearms And Ammunition For The Duration Of The Order Where A Separate Finding Has Been Made That The Respondent's Continued Retention Of Firearms And Ammunition Poses A Risk To The Health And Safety Of The Petitioner, Any Minor Children, Or Any Person Alleged To Be Incompetent; To Amend…
Died In Committee (2026-02-12)
